作者:雷神
微信公衆號:iFTrue未來已來
1 工作空間
以CCS8.0爲例,在CCS啓動時,會彈出工作空間(Workspace)選擇對話框,工作空間是用來保存開發過程中用到的所有元素(包括項目和指向項目的鏈接等)的目錄。
Workspace的默認路徑爲:C:UsersAdministratorworkspace_v8,也可以根據需求任意選擇位置。
每次打開CCS時都會彈出工作空間選擇對話框,我們可以對所有項目使用一個目錄,這時可以勾選“Use this as the default and do not ask again(默認使用此目錄且不再詢問)”,下次再打開CCS時就不會彈出了。
這裏我們保持Workspace路徑爲默認路徑,同時暫不勾選“Use this as the default and do not ask again”,點擊“Launch”按鈕進入軟件主界面。
2 創建一個新的CCS工程
1、 打開菜單欄“Project -> New CCS Project…”
2、 在彈出的窗口中,“Project name”中填寫項目名稱。若選中“Use default location”,將會在工作空間路徑下創建項目;若想選則其他位置存放項目,則去掉勾選“Use default location”,並使用“Browse…”選擇新的位置。
3、 在“Target”中選擇要使用的芯片類型。
4、 在“Connection”中選擇你使用的仿真器。
5、 點擊“Finish”完成項目創建
6、 至此,一個最簡單的CCS工程已經完成,只不過這是一個空的工程,我們還需要根據實際需求去在這個工程中寫自己的源代碼或者添加已有的代碼。在“Project Explorer”窗口中可以看到我們新建的工程(“Project Explorer”窗口未顯示的話,可以在菜單“Window -> Show View -> Project Explorer”中打開)。
以下步驟根據實際需求選擇進行,若無需求直接進入第3章“編譯與生成”:
7、 要爲工程創建文件(.c、.h、.asm、.cpp等),請在右鍵單擊工程名稱,選擇“New->Source File”添加源文件或“New->Header File”添加頭文件。
8、 在彈出的對話框中,填寫源文件名稱“Source File”,注意要正確填寫後綴類型(.c、.h、.asm、.cpp等),點擊“Finish”完成。頭文件(Header File)的填寫方式類似。
9、 如果添加已有的源文件,請在右鍵單擊工程名稱,選擇“Add Files…”,並選擇要添加的文件。
10、在彈出的對話框中,選擇“Copy Files to Project”,將文件複製到工程中。並點擊“OK”。
3 編譯與生成
在工程創建完成後,需要對工程進行編譯,以檢測是否有錯誤並且生成可執行文件。打開菜單“Project -> Build Project”,CCS會對工程進行編譯。
當“Console”窗口中顯示“**** Build Finished ****”時編譯完成。如果有錯誤或警告,會在“Problems”窗口中提示。
提示:如果你的CCS沒有顯示“Problems”窗口,可點擊菜單“Window -> Show View -> Problems”打開。